请使用python语言写一个谷歌 LaMDA模型?
时间: 2023-01-11 16:55:36 浏览: 82
好的,这是一个使用 Python 语言写的谷歌 LaMDA 模型的示例代码:
```
import tensorflow as tf
import tensorflow_datasets as tfds
# 下载并准备数据集
dataset, info = tfds.load('tf_agents/traffic_jams:2.0.0', with_info=True)
train_dataset = dataset['train']
# 建立模型
model = tf.keras.Sequential([
tf.keras.layers.LSTM(64),
tf.keras.layers.Dense(info.features['label'].num_classes)
])
# 编译模型
model.compile(optimizer='adam',
loss=tf.losses.SparseCategoricalCrossentropy(from_logits=True),
metrics=['accuracy'])
# 训练模型
model.fit(train_dataset, epochs=10)
```
这是一个使用 TensorFlow 库实现的简单 LaMDA 模型。这里使用了一个 LSTM 层和一个密集层,并使用 Adam 优化器和稀疏分类交叉熵损失函数来编译模型。然后将模型训练10个 epoch。
这只是一个简单的示例代码,您可能需要对模型进行调整以获得更好的结果。希望这能帮到您。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)